Depor secure low-key salvation

Deportivo La Coruna secured their La Liga safety with one match remaining after a hard-fought scoreless draw at Villarreal.

Pepe Mel’s side have secured only one victory from their last ten outings and had been sliding dangerously close to the drop.

Depor now cannot be caught by 18th-placed Sporting Gijon who despite being only three points worse off have an inferior head-to-head record this season.

Villarreal dominated this match with 14 efforts to just the one from the Galicians but a combination of wayward finishing and a strong goalkeeping performance from German Lux was enough to keep them out.

The Yellow Submarine remain fifth in the table but this result could yet prove damaging – it ensures they can no longer catch 4th-placed Sevilla while they could yet slip out of the top six altogether, with Basque duo Athletic Club and Real Sociedad both only a point behind.

That would mean no European football for Fran Escriba’s side next season and must now win at Valencia on the final day to ensure it.

Depor host out-of-form Las Palmas but will be relieved at their low-key salvation.
